More manufacturers confirm apperance at Carole Nash MCN London Show
The Carole Nash MCN Motorcycle Show at the ExCeL centre in London’s Docklands will feature more major motorcycle manufacturers than any other bike show in the UK.
Italian manufacturer’s Aprilia and Moto Guzzi as well as Barcelona based manufacturer Derbi are also amongst the latest to confirm their attendance at the show, taking place from Feb 4-7.
They join an impressive looking line-up where the top of the bill are undoubtedly Honda and Harley-Davidson – two manufacturers who decided not to attend the Carole Nash International Motorcycle and Scooter show at the NEC late last year.
Aprilia’s attendance was confirmed by the Piaggio Group, who will also be bringing their Vespa, Gilera and Piaggion brands to London this year.
Exact bikes are yet to be confirmed but Piaggio’s Phil Read says they are pulling out all the stops to make sure the Carole Nash MCN Motorcycle Show will be a real showcase for the Piaggio Group.
“Piaggio Group are delighted to bring models from our entire brand portfolio to the Carole Nash MCN Motorcycle Show and we look forward to confirming some special guests and rare displays of exciting machines,” he said.
The latest manufacturers join the list of attendees that already includes Ducati, Triumph, Norton, Kawasaki, BMW and Yamaha, who will be represented by dealer group George White.
